- 中文摘要: Fluorescence from S/sub 2/Cl induced by radiation at 488nm was observed when the parent molecule S/sub 2/ Cl/sub 2/ was heated. The dependence of the intensity of fluorescence is third order on laser power. The mechanism of excitation is proposed to be dissociation of hot S/sub 2/ Cl/sub 2/ after two-photon absorption to yield hot S/sub 2/ Cl and one-photon absorption of the latter to reach the fluorescing states. The fluorescence spectrum consists of two systems, called .alpha. and .beta. here. The lower state of the .alpha. system is the ground state X.wiggle. and that of the .beta. system is assumed to be the A.wiggle. state. The upper states of both systems are unknown but may be related to previously observed states lying about 460nm and 330nm. The vibrational structure of the .beta. system was partially analyzed. The vibrational quantum numbers of the v/sub 2/ and the v/sub 3/ modes in the upper state are assessed to be .gtoreq.6 and 0, respectively, from a count of the number of nodes of the curves of the fluorescence intensity distribution. From the abrupt termination of the intensity curve of v/sub 2/" progressions, the absolute v/sub 2/" quantum numbers were determined. The excitation was in this way assigned to be (p, q+6,0)'.arrl.(m,4,n+3)", in which p, q, m and n are non-negative integers.
